Solution

The correct option is A The epiglottis covers the glottis
In man, even though both air and food go through the pharynx, food does not normally enter the windpipe because during swallowing of food the epiglottis a cartilaginous flap covers the glottis so that the food does not accidently move into the wind pipe.
